Max Crispe

Max-Crispe-Profile

Max was born in Albany, Western Australia and studied Economics at UWA before attaining his law degree.

Max was admitted to practice in 1978 and joined the city practice of Kott Gunning. Over a period of 19 years, Max worked his way up from a solicitor to senior partner, heading Kott Gunning’s criminal and traffic practice.

In 1997, Max opened his own practice as a sole practitioner specialising in criminal and traffic law. Max Crispe Barristers & Solicitors now employs four solicitors who work exclusively in criminal and traffic matters.

Max is a highly experienced trial lawyer, having successfully defended clients in all Courts throughout Western Australia. He has represented his client’s interests in the High Court of Australia, Supreme Court, District Court, Magistrates Court and Children’s Court.

Max has over 40 years’ experience exclusively in criminal law.  Over that time he has been involved in some of Western Australia’s highest profile criminal matters.

Kate Crispe

Kate-Crispe-profile

Kate completed her law degree at the University of Western Australia and has been admitted to practice by the Legal Practice Board of Western Australia in both State and Federal Jurisdictions.

Kate commenced work at a top tier commercial firm in Perth working in commercial litigation and insurance before joining Max Crispe Barristers & Solicitors in 2015.

Kate is an experienced senior lawyer whose strengths lie in legal analysis and in-depth review of prosecution briefs to find solutions for complex matters. Kate specifically enjoys analysing case law, legislation and appearing in Courts to argue points of law. Her strengths also lie in negotiating charges with prosecuting agencies for the early resolution of matters, often with cost awards granted by the Courts against WA Police.
Kate has experience representing clients in all Courts in Western Australia and works tirelessly to get the best possible result for her clients.

Kate is also a qualified Physiotherapist and this knowledge has provided invaluable experience dealing with offences involving injury analysis including grievous bodily harm and assaults.

Margot Perling

Margot Perling-profile

Margot was admitted to practice in 2011 after completing a double degree in Law and Psychology at Murdoch University. She has worked as a criminal defence lawyer since this time.

She completed articles under the pupillage of some of Perth’s leading barristers at Albert Wolf Chambers, following which she has worked at various criminal law firms in Perth before joining Max Crispe Barristers and Solicitors in 2020.

Margot is a Senior Criminal lawyer who has represented clients in all Courts in Western Australia for a wide range of matters. She is experienced in conducting jury trials and is passionate about advocating on behalf of her clients.

She is able to assist with any police charge matter, criminal property confiscation matter and criminal injury compensation matter.
